Gnats, anyone?
Thousands and thousands of gnats everywhere. Extremely aggressive gnats.
I can't even eat a decent meal. I have to keep EVERYTHING completely covered and sneak quick bites before the gnats get it.
I've found gnats in my nachos (I'm not kidding), gnats floating in my iced tea.
The best way to kill gnats is with bowls of vinegar. They love vinegar and will quickly dive in the bowl - never to emerge again (I use plain white vinegar).
Add one or two drops (no more) of dishwashing liquid into the vinegar. This will assure that the gnats won't escape (that might just be an old wives tale, but I do it anyway).
Use OLD bowls that you never want to use again. I usually use old pet food dishes,
These are bowls of gnats that I caught only within a few hours. I presently have three bowls of vinegar in different rooms.
It looks completely disgusting, but the vinegar really works.
